Transaction 83684befcce30e190fc29acbb2b15452aa50e3d9823a537906e97e63580f2629
1 Input
1 Output
-
83684befcce30e190fc29acbb2b15452aa50e3d9823a537906e97e63580f2629:0
- value
- 71739
- script pubkey
- OP_0 OP_PUSHBYTES_20 1520ab1c35c0171b23bc611e00b76989c63bd1cf
- address
- bc1qz5s2k8p4cqt3kgauvy0qpdmf38rrh5w05k827c